From the legal point of view, in Spain there is no express obligation to vaccinate children.

Organic Law 3/86 in its second article dictates that “The authorities may take any type of measures to preserve public health, with the only requirement that there are rational indications that it is in danger. Any measures are allowed in cases of epidemics or borderline situations ”. Although it does not explicitly refer to vaccines, we can deduce that in extreme cases such as epidemics it would be worth the obligation.

However, vaccination of the child is strongly recommended from the health and educational field, up to almost imposed.
